Ok, I need to get some homework done and go to bed.  For the time being:

- There are no odd services listening or connections established.  But that doesn't mean anything.
- I've changed the root password, but I don't believe that he ever got access to root.
- I've changed the MySQL password (you might have noticed the authentication failure). 
- I've hacked the SMF board to give myself administrator-type power.  I don't have time to muck around with names and stuff tonight, maybe later.  If you're nice.
- I've disconnected everybody who had an active connection.

For everything else, I'm going to leave it as business as usual.  I can't tell what happened, so there's no sense in closing the gate after the horse escaped.

As MyndFyre said (while I was typing this, *grr*), he straightened everything up.  You can fix your names (Except Sigh Dough.. we alll agree that you should keep that name). 

As far as we can tell, somebody either found out or guessed an Administrator's password on the forum (probably Quik, he's a n00b (kidding)).  We've fixed it so he can't get back in through that route.  Hopefully that's all he did...

Hopefully, it's all back to normal.  I'm still going to dig through some logs and see if I can find out who actually did it.  All I know at this point is that he was going through a proxy, but I might be able to dig up some records on the proxy, who knows?

Hmm, on that day there was a lot of traffic from 207.180.144.222...

Also, I checked up on the proxy that the "pnc" account was using.. I found their logs, an it turns out that 207.180.144.222 was the ip that was posting as phc, so I'm sure it's the same guy.

So I looked up the ip 207.180.144.222 on the forums, and there is one account associated with it: Hitmen

Also, Nov, 6 was the day that Hitmen created his account on this forum. 

Also, Dec. 1 (the day of the "incident") was Hitmen's birthday. 

Now, the problem is, I always thought that the Hitmen I knew was inept.  So how, suddenly, did this happen? 

Your answer is as good as mine..... for the time being, I'm not sure how to proceed...
